We are looking for an experienced Server and Network Engineer, specialising in Cyber Security Infrastructure, to join our network team. This role is primarily focused on the support, maintenance, and operational stability of our Cyber business's infrastructure. The ideal candidate will have deep hands-on experience with designing, implementing and maintaining secure network environments and technologies, to acknowledged security standards. They will be able to identify, remediate and respond to vulnerabilities and alerts, across the environment. The role requires extensive knowledge of administering and securing firewalls, load balancers, pentesting solutions, SIEM solutions and cloud networking environments.

Key Responsibilities

  • Provide 3rd line support for enterprise network issues, ensuring minimal downtime and high availability.
  • Maintain and optimize network infrastructure, including Cisco, Meraki, FortiNet technologies.
  • Administer and troubleshoot Palo Alto firewalls and Panorama.
  • Administer and troubleshoot Zscaler ZIA/ZPA for secure internet and remote access.
  • Support cloud network environments with a focus on Microsoft Azure, including VNets, ExpressRoute, VPNs, and security groups.
  • Manage and support Cisco Meraki wireless, switching, and security appliances.
  • Work closely with 1st/2nd line teams to elevate and resolve network incidents.
  • Contribute to low-level design and documentation for new solutions and improvements to existing infrastructure.
  • Monitor and tune network performance, using tools and monitoring systems.
  • Ensure all changes are documented and follow the internal change management process.
  • Participate in on-call rotations and provide out-of-hours support when required.

Skills & Experience Required

  • Proven experience in a 3rd line network support role within a medium to large enterprise.
  • Strong knowledge of Cisco routing and switching, including hands-on work with Catalyst 9000 series, ASA, and Firepower.
  • Solid experience supporting Palo Alto firewalls in a production environment.
  • Working knowledge of Zscaler ZIA and ZPA.
  • Strong understanding of Microsoft Azure networking, including hybrid connectivity setups.
  • Experience managing Cisco Meraki infrastructure.
  • Good understanding of networking protocols (e.g., BGP, OSPF, VPN, NAT, ACLs).
  • Ability to work independently and handle high-pressure situations with calm and professionalism.
  • Excellent documentation and communication skills.

Desirable Certifications (Nice to Have)

  • Cisco certifications (e.g., CCNA, CCNP or equivalent experience)
  • Palo Alto PCNSE
  • Microsoft Certified: Azure Network Engineer Associate
  • Zscaler certifications (ZCCP or equivalent)
